1. DMCA Safe Harbor

CueSoul qualifies for safe harbor protection under the DMCA as an online service provider that hosts user-submitted content. To maintain this protection, CueSoul responds expeditiously to valid takedown notices and has a policy of terminating repeat infringers.

2. Submitting a Copyright Infringement Notice (Takedown Request)

If you believe content on CueSoul.ai infringes your copyright, you must submit a written notice containing ALL of the following elements required under 17 U.S.C. § 512(c)(3):

  1. Your signature (physical or electronic) as the copyright owner or authorized agent
  2. Identification of the copyrighted work you claim has been infringed — provide specific title, registration number if available, and description
  3. Identification of the infringing material — provide the specific URL(s) on CueSoul.ai where the infringing content appears
  4. Your contact information — name, address, telephone number, and email address
  5. A statement of good faith belief — "I have a good faith belief that use of the material in the manner complained of is not authorized by the copyright owner, its agent, or the law."
  6. A statement of accuracy under penalty of perjury — "The information in this notification is accurate, and I am the copyright owner or am authorized to act on behalf of the owner."

Warning: Under 17 U.S.C. § 512(f), any person who knowingly materially misrepresents that material is infringing may be subject to liability for damages, including costs and attorney's fees. Do not submit a takedown notice if you are not the copyright owner or authorized agent.

3. CueSoul's Response Process

  1. Upon receipt of a valid, complete DMCA notice, CueSoul will acknowledge receipt within 3 business days
  2. CueSoul will notify the affected artist of the takedown notice
  3. If the notice meets all DMCA requirements, CueSoul will remove or disable access to the allegedly infringing content within 10 business days pending counter-notification
  4. CueSoul will investigate the artist's ownership declaration on file
  5. CueSoul will provide the complaining party with confirmation of removal

4. Counter-Notification (Artist Response to Takedown)

If you are an artist whose content was removed and you believe the removal was in error or the result of misidentification, you may submit a counter-notification containing:

  1. Your physical or electronic signature
  2. Identification of the material removed and its location before removal
  3. A statement under penalty of perjury that you have a good faith belief the material was removed or disabled as a result of mistake or misidentification
  4. Your name, address, and telephone number
  5. A statement consenting to jurisdiction of the federal district court for the district in which your address is located

Upon receipt of a valid counter-notification, CueSoul will notify the original complainant and may restore the content within 10–14 business days unless the complainant files a court action.

5. Repeat Infringer Policy

CueSoul maintains a strict repeat infringer policy. Artists who receive two or more valid, uncontested DMCA takedown notices will have their accounts permanently terminated without refund. This policy is necessary to maintain CueSoul's DMCA safe harbor protection.

6. False Ownership Declarations

All CueSoul artists sign an ownership declaration at submission. An artist who submits music they do not own — resulting in a valid DMCA takedown — is in material breach of the Artist Agreement and subject to immediate account termination and potential legal action by CueSoul for damages incurred in processing the dispute.
